September 6, 2019 – In the coming weeks, several residential streets in the City of Midland will see improvements as part of the 2019 surface treatment program.
The program provides a cost-effective preventative maintenance solution to improve and preserve the quality of City streets by smoothing road surfaces, correcting imperfections, and applying a protective seal to local roadways.
The following roads will see surface treatment:
- Aspen Way – including sidewalk ramp improvement at Countryside and Aspen
- Gettysburg Street
- Illinois Drive – including sidewalk ramp improvements at Todd and Gettysburg
- Plumtree Lane – including sidewalk ramp improvement at Dublin Avenue
- Rowe Court
- Springfield Drive - including sidewalk ramp improvements at Todd and Gettysburg
- Todd Street
The program is expected to last three to four weeks.
